Hampton Court Macanudo review (cigar cigars)
I was gifted a bunch of these. Tonight I tried the maduro. I didn't care
much for it. The aroma was rather off-putting. the draw was very tight. In
the mouth, the cigar felt gritty and tasted peppry, not so much the flavor
as the sting...rahter unpleasent. The cigar burned well but became plugged
after about an inch. From that point on it was too much work to smoke. I
wouldn't buy this cigar. If it sold for $2.00 it would be fair game for
those looking for an inexpensive smoke. However, there are better cigars at
that price. I've got a couple of others in the same line. I hope they are
better.
